Specifications
Amplifier
Output Voltage
1000 mV RMS
Signal to Noise Ratio
> 62 dBA
Total Harmonic Distortion
< 2 %
Bluetooth
Standard
Bluetooth  Standard Version 
2.1+EDR
Frequency Band 2.402~2.480 GHzISM Band
Range
10m (free space)
General information
AC Power
Model: AS030-090-
EI033 (Philips);
Input: 100-240 V ~, 
50/60 Hz, 0.15 A;
Output:  9 V   0.33 A
Operation Power 
Consumption
 
< 3 W
Dimensions - Main Unit 
(W x H x D)
 
74 x 28 x 72 mm
Weight - Main Unit
0.04 kg
5 Troubleshooting
Warning
 
Never remove the casing of this device.
To keep the warranty valid, never try to repair 
the system yourself. 
If you encounter problems when using this 
device, check the following points before 
requesting service. If the problem remains 
unsolved, go to the Philips Web page  
(www.philips.com/support). When you contact
Philips, make sure that the device is nearby 
and the model number and serial number are 
available.
No power
 • Make sure that the AC power adapter is 
connected properly.
 • Make sure that there is power at the AC 
outlet.
No sound from your Hi-Fi system
 • Check if the Hi-Fi system is connected to 
power.
 • Make sure that the system is connected 
with the Bluetooth adapter properly.
 • Make sure that the Bluetooth wireless 
connection is successful.
 • Adjust the volume of your system and 
Bluetooth device. 
 • Make sure that the Hi-Fi system is in 
Audio-in or line-in mode. 
About Bluetooth device
The audio quality is poor after connection 
with a Bluetooth-enabled device.
 • The Bluetooth reception is poor. Move the 
device closer to the Bluetooth adaptor or 
remove any obstacle between the device 
and the adaptor.
